On-site and Off-site Parking Facilities

Salisbury Cathedral offers both on-site and off-site parking facilities, catering to the needs of different visitors. The on-site parking area, known as the Cathedral Close Car Park, is conveniently located just a short walk from the Cathedral itself. It provides ample parking spaces for both cars and motorcycles, ensuring easy access for those who wish to explore the Cathedral and its surroundings at their own pace.

Alternatively, for those who prefer off-site parking, there are several options within walking distance of the Cathedral. The Central Car Park, situated near the city center, is a popular choice. It offers a large parking area and is easily accessible from major roads. Additionally, the Maltings Car Park, located close to the Cathedral, provides a convenient parking option for those wanting to explore the Cathedral and nearby attractions.

Disabled Parking and Accessible Options

Salisbury Cathedral recognizes the importance of providing accessible parking options for those with disabilities. Within the Cathedral Close Car Park, designated spaces are available for disabled visitors, ensuring convenient access to the Cathedral and its facilities. These spaces are located close to accessible entrances, making it easier for individuals with mobility challenges to navigate the area.

Moreover, the Cathedral also offers wheelchair loan services, enabling disabled visitors to explore the Cathedral comfortably. Wheelchairs can be borrowed from the Cathedral’s entrance and provide an excellent means of enjoying the stunning architecture and rich history within. The Cathedral is committed to ensuring that everyone can experience its beauty and significance, irrespective of their mobility challenges.
